Eijsermans family tree » Cornelis Franciscus Schoofs (1879-1941)

Personal data Cornelis Franciscus Schoofs 

  • He was born on October 17, 1879 in Tilburg.

  • He died on January 5, 1941 in Tilburg, he was 61 years old.

  • A child of Hendrikus Schoofs and Wilhelmina Vugts
